1977 450SL (60,298) Miles *Is it worth it?
Hello Gentlemen, or if your only 40 and people call you sir and you hate it, "Whats up Guys".
I have a chance to buy a 77 450sl with 60,000 miles for $2500.00 Looks and runs great, except that it wont reverse.So right now it looks like I may need to FRED FLINSTONE it to get out of the drive way. My question is, do any of you think that with only 60,000 miles it is premature for it to need a rebuild? I read somewhere that there is some type of "adjustments" that can resolve the problems. I'd be suspicious of a that... First the 3-speed tranny's are extremely reliable. Something must have happened... I'd want to find that out otherwise I'd pass...
I did a rebuild at 110K only because there was a amall leak and I plan on keeping the car for a long time. Now, you have relatively low miles so maybe the car has been sitting up for a long time... the rubber parts will deteriorate... What you don;t want is a money pit. IF you are as rabid a owner as most of us here, it will be hard to not what to fix the things as they go bad..

Mark Herzig in the previous post has a very good point--If the car has been sitting for a couple of years or more, you could end up with a lot of bad seals, and spend a lot of time and $$ fixing leaks. Early 70s models are bad about rusting too, so check it out VERY carefully! If it has always been a CA car, rust probably won't be an issue, though...
